Retail Trade - January 2016

Higher interest in purchase of cultural and recreation goods

14.03.2016
Code: 120019-16
 

In January 2016, sales in retail trade after seasonal adjustment increased at constant prices by 1.2%, month-on-month (m-o-m). Working days adjusted sales increased by 5.8%, year‑on-year (y-o-y), non-adjusted by 4.6%.  

Seasonally adjusted sales in retail trade except of motor vehicles and motorcycles (CZ‑NACE 47) increased at constant prices by 1.2%, month-on-month. Sales adjusted for calendar effects increased by 5.8%, year-on-year; non-adjusted sales increased by 4.6% (there was one working day less in January 2016 than in January 2015). Non-adjusted sales for sale of automotive fuel increased by 6.1%, year-on-year, for non-food goods they increased by 5.3%, y-o-y, and for food by 3.2%.

The highest growth was recorded by retail sale via mail order houses or via Internet (by 15.4%). Retail sale of cultural and recreation goods in specialised stores increased by 14.9%, which was the most since October 2008. Sales increased also for clothing and footwear (by 7.3%), other household equipment in specialised stores (by 3.2%), and for information and communication equipment (by 0.9%). Sales of food retailers increased by 3.5% in non-specialised stores and by 0.3% in specialised stores. On the contrary, consumers showed lower interest in purchases of dispensing chemist, medical and orthopaedic goods (by 3.6%).

The price deflator (CZ-NACE 47) related to the corresponding period of the previous year (VAT excluded) was 97.6%. It was influenced mainly by lower prices of automotive fuel, food, and information and communication equipment. On the contrary, prices increased in stores with cultural and recreation goods, clothing and footwear, and dispensing chemist, medical and orthopaedic goods.

Seasonally adjusted sales for sale and repair of motor vehicles (CZ-NACE 45) increased at constant prices by 3.0%, m-o-m. Sales adjusted for calendar effects increased by 10.7%, y-o-y. Non-adjusted sales increased by 7.3%, y-o-y, sales for sale of motor vehicles (including spare parts) increased by 8.4% and for repair of motor vehicles by 2.4%.
